HTML5是当前最流行的网页开发标准,自2014年正式发布以来,它已经成为了构建现代网站和网页应用的事实标准。本篇文章将为您全面解析HTML5的基础知识点,帮助您快速入门。
一、HTML5的基本结构
HTML5文档的基本结构如下: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
1.1 DOCTYPE声明
<!DOCTYPE html> 声明定义了文档类型和版本,告诉浏览器使用哪种HTML版本进行解析。
1.2 <html> 标签
<html> 标签是HTML文档的根元素,包含了整个文档的所有内容。
1.3 <head> 标签
<head> 标签包含了文档的元数据,如字符集、标题、样式和脚本等。
1.4 <title> 标签
<title> 标签定义了文档的标题,显示在浏览器的标签页上。
1.5 <body> 标签
<body> 标签包含了文档的可视内容,如文本、图片、链接等。
二、HTML5常用标签
2.1 文本内容标签
<h1>至<h6>:定义标题,<h1>为最高级别,<h6>为最低级别。<p>:定义段落。<a>:定义超链接。
2.2 嵌入式标签
<img>:定义图像。<audio>:定义音频内容。<video>:定义视频内容。
2.3 表格标签
<table>:定义表格。<tr>:定义表格行。<th>:定义表格头。<td>:定义表格单元格。
2.4 表单标签
<form>:定义表单。<input>:定义输入字段。<button>:定义按钮。<select>:定义下拉列表。
三、HTML5新特性
3.1 增强的语义化标签
HTML5引入了许多新的语义化标签,如 <header>、<footer>、<nav>、<article>、<section> 等,使页面结构更加清晰。
3.2 媒体元素
HTML5引入了 <audio> 和 <video> 元素,使网页可以直接播放音频和视频,无需第三方插件。
3.3 跨文档通信
HTML5提供了WebSocket技术,实现了浏览器与服务器之间的实时双向通信。
3.4 地理位置信息
HTML5支持地理位置API,使网页能够获取用户的地理位置信息。
四、总结
HTML5是当前最流行的网页开发标准,具有丰富的功能和特性。通过学习HTML5的基础知识点,您可以快速入门并构建出更加精美、功能强大的网页。希望本文能对您有所帮助。
